Resort Lifestyle Communities (RLC) is a fast-growing, family-owned company operating over 60 senior living communities nationwide. They focus on creating supportive, resort-style environments that enhance the lives of seniors while providing meaningful employment opportunities. With a strong foundation built on core values such as respect, honesty, kindness, compassion, and service excellence, RLC aims to foster a close-knit, servant-hearted community where both employees and residents thrive. Their mission revolves around four essential goals: happy employees, happy residents, full occupancy, and on-budget operations, creating a balanced and successful business model centered on care and community. RLC stands out by offering a purpose-driven workplace where staff members feel valued and are encouraged to make a positive difference every day.
The Cook position at Resort Lifestyle Communities is a critical role responsible for delivering exceptional dining experiences to residents. Working in a scratch-based kitchen, the cook prepares a diverse array of entrées and side dishes, ensuring that every plate is not only high quality but also visually appealing and portioned according to the preferences of the residents. This role demands a strong commitment to food safety and sanitation, meticulous attention to detail, and efficiency in kitchen preparation and cooking methods such as broiling, grilling, frying, and sautéing. Beyond food preparation, the cook aids in maintaining a welcoming dining atmosphere by building positive relationships with residents, guests, and team members, contributing to a warm and home-like environment.
The position requires the ability to work a consistent schedule primarily from Thursday to Monday, covering shifts from before lunch until dinner service ends at 6:30 pm, with occasional morning shifts as needed. Candidates must be at least 18 years or older and have the capacity to read, speak, and understand basic English. Experience in kitchen preparation and cooking is preferred but not mandatory. A vital requirement is the ability to acquire the necessary food handler permits within two weeks of commencing employment, adhering strictly to local health and safety regulations.
Key responsibilities include preparing high-quality dishes by utilizing various cooking methods to produce appealing and flavorful meals. The cook engages in continuous improvement by contributing ideas during team meetings, accepting feedback openly, and ensuring attentive coverage of the service line during meal hours. The role also involves completing all assigned opening and closing tasks such as morning setups and end-of-day cleanups, supporting team members, maintaining a clean, organized, and safe kitchen environment, and keeping cooking stations well-stocked by managing food supplies and monitoring refrigeration. Sanitation is a top priority, requiring thorough cleaning of work areas and equipment as well as regular checking and recording of food safety parameters.
Resort Lifestyle Communities offers competitive compensation along with a generous benefits package for full-time employees. Benefits include a $341 benefit stipend per pay period usable toward health, dental, and vision insurance, life insurance, short- and long-term disability coverage, health savings accounts (HSA), flexible spending accounts (FSA), limited spending accounts (LSA), accident and hospital indemnity insurance, and legal and identity theft protection. In addition, employees enjoy paid time off and a 401(k) retirement plan with employer matching. RLC's supportive leadership and beautiful workplace settings make it an attractive employer, fostering personal growth and a meaningful career in senior living hospitality.
